    Meaning of Dilemmatic

    The primary meaning of the word "Dilemmatic" refers to a situation or problem that is difficult to resolve or decide upon due to conflicting options or unclear circumstances.

    Definitions

    • Relating to or resembling a dilemma, especially one that is difficult to resolve due to conflicting options or unclear circumstances.
    • * Characterized by or involving a situation in which a difficult choice has to be made between two or more alternatives, neither of which is clearly preferable.

    Etymology of Dilemmatic

    The word "Dilemmatic" originates from the Greek word "δίλημμα" (dilemma), which refers to a double proposition, and the suffix "-atic", which forms an adjective indicating a relationship or resemblance to the root word.
    Historically, the term has been used in philosophy, logic, and rhetoric to describe a situation in which an argument or a choice is presented with two or more conflicting options, making it difficult to decide or resolve.
